Tesla founder Elon Musk surpassed Microsoft co-founder Bill Gates to become the second-richest person in the world, according to the Bloomberg Billionaires Index. 

Musk added $100.3 billion to his net worth in 2020, more than any other person on Bloomberg’s ranking of the top 500 richest people in the world, Bloomberg News reported. In the most recent surge, Musk’s net worth jumped $7.2 billion, reaching $127.9 billion.

Gates, who is currently valued at $127.7 billion, has donated billions to charity since his fame, including $27 billion to the Gates Foundation since 2006, according to Bloomberg News.
